using System; using System.Buffers.Binary; using System.Text; using AcDream.Core.Net.Messages; using Xunit; namespace AcDream.Core.Net.Tests.Messages; /// /// Phase I.5: 0x019E PlayerKilled parser. Wire layout per holtburger /// PlayerKilledData: string16L deathMessage + u32 victimGuid + u32 /// killerGuid. /// public sealed class PlayerKilledTests { [Fact] public void TryParse_RoundTrips_AllThreeFields() { // Synthetic payload mirroring holtburger's test_player_killed_fixture // (combat/types.rs lines 100-115). Death message = "Test", victim = // 0x12345678, killer = 0x90ABCDEF. byte[] msg = PackString16L("Test"); byte[] body = new byte[4 + msg.Length + 8]; int pos = 0; BinaryPrimitives.WriteUInt32LittleEndian(body.AsSpan(pos), PlayerKilled.Opcode); pos += 4; Array.Copy(msg, 0, body, pos, msg.Length); pos += msg.Length; BinaryPrimitives.WriteUInt32LittleEndian(body.AsSpan(pos), 0x12345678u); pos += 4; BinaryPrimitives.WriteUInt32LittleEndian(body.AsSpan(pos), 0x90ABCDEFu); var parsed = PlayerKilled.TryParse(body); Assert.NotNull(parsed); Assert.Equal("Test", parsed!.Value.DeathMessage); Assert.Equal(0x12345678u, parsed.Value.VictimGuid); Assert.Equal(0x90ABCDEFu, parsed.Value.KillerGuid); } [Fact] public void TryParse_WrongOpcode_ReturnsNull() { byte[] body = new byte[16]; BinaryPrimitives.WriteUInt32LittleEndian(body, 0xDEADBEEFu); Assert.Null(PlayerKilled.TryParse(body)); } [Fact] public void TryParse_TruncatedAfterMessage_ReturnsNull() { byte[] msg = PackString16L("died"); byte[] body = new byte[4 + msg.Length + 4]; // only one guid present BinaryPrimitives.WriteUInt32LittleEndian(body, PlayerKilled.Opcode); Array.Copy(msg, 0, body, 4, msg.Length); Assert.Null(PlayerKilled.TryParse(body)); } private static byte[] PackString16L(string s) { byte[] data = Encoding.GetEncoding(1252).GetBytes(s); int recordSize = 2 + data.Length; int padding = (4 - (recordSize & 3)) & 3; byte[] result = new byte[recordSize + padding]; BinaryPrimitives.WriteUInt16LittleEndian(result, (ushort)data.Length); Array.Copy(data, 0, result, 2, data.Length); return result; } }
